Transaction 603e57b137c52ec39ab05024b22345c9040f249de25a142c2bdd215fcd5363db
1 Input
1 Output
-
603e57b137c52ec39ab05024b22345c9040f249de25a142c2bdd215fcd5363db:0
- value
- 515077
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b60b9383687ff4d80f1cab275e121947309ae36b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HbZrF7NNJ6ZZ1nbEqvQCmUfYbpfh8n5Rk